About Lebberston Touring Park

Lebberston Touring Park is hidden away between the edge of the picturesque Yorkshire Wolds and the spectacular Heritage Coast of North Yorkshire.

Lebberston Touring Park Description

Our caravan site offers great surroundings to relax and unwind and is perfect for those seeking a restful break on a tranquil park. Ideally suited for quiet couples, singles and young families, our location means that, while it feels as though you’re in the middle of nowhere with fabulous views over the Vale of Pickering and the Yorkshire Wolds, in reality you are so near to civilisation that you can be shopping in Scarborough town centre or eating fish and chips on the front in Filey in no time.

It's not long now until the Tour de Yorkshire. We thought you'd like some info about what's happening on Stage 3 along the spectacular Yorkshire Coast so you can get yourself organised.
It's on Saturday 5th May 2018 and is just 184km long - no sweat!
Race Timings...... A caravan of 30 decorated vehicles will be driving the Stage 3 route about an hour before the race, to hand out souvenirs and bring a carnival atmosphere so make sure you're in situ an hour ahead of these times to enjoy the party!
1. Richmond - Official Start 13:20 2. Northallerton - 14:15 3. Thirsk - 14:36 4. Sutton Bank - 14:50 5. Helmsley - 15:06 6. Pickering - 15:35 7. Scalby - 16:25 8. Scarborough - 16:29 9. Filey - 16:48 10. Scarborough - 17:26
If you're looking for some race day family fun here are some ideas.....
Lots of Filey fun to particiapte in! Including RNLI open weekend, giant sand art, and musical performances from musicians at Filey Folk Festival at venues throughout the town.
In Scarborough there are free Family Fun Zone activities for everyone to enjoy on race day. They include, a climbing wall, a giant inflatable assault course and face painting.
Other events to check out in Scarborough over the weekend are the Food Fair, Festival of Speed and the Vintage Fair.
All this and it's a Bank Holiday weekend so you get an extra day off work!

Have stayed at Lebberston since the kids were little, this is a great site for families, with a lovely big playing field visible from your van. Spacious pitches with electric, some slightly sloping depending where you are on site. Spotlessly clean throughout with excellent facilities including a family bathroom and laundry. Lovely and quiet, and staff are on hand even after hours to make sure it stays that way. Basics are available from the small reception shop and there is a bus stop close by on the main road if you want to visit any of the local towns. There is also an enclosed dog walk and separate nature area. Highly recommended, we go back year after year.
